Thanksgiving Stuffed Mushrooms

Delight your guests with these Thanksgiving Stuffed Mushrooms, combining traditional holiday flavors into perfect bite-sized appetizers. These savory mushrooms are filled with a fragrant blend of herbed stuffing, juicy cranberries, and seasoned sausage, making them an irresistible addition to any autumn gathering.
Prep time: 15 minutes
Cook time: 20 minutes
Serves: 6

Ingredients

24 whole button mushrooms
8 oz sausage, removed from casing
1 cup prepared stuffing mix
1/4 cup dried cranberries
1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
2 tbsp chopped fresh parsley
2 tbsp butter
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
2. Clean mushrooms and remove stems, hollowing out the caps.
3. In a skillet over medium heat, cook sausage until browned and crumbly.
4. In a bowl, combine cooked sausage, stuffing mix, cranberries, Parmesan, and parsley.
5. Stuff each mushroom cap generously with the mixture.
6. Place mushrooms on a baking sheet and dot each with a bit of butter.
7. Bake for 20 minutes, or until mushrooms are tender and stuffing is golden.
8. Serve warm.

Storage

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

Reheating

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and warm mushrooms for 10 minutes or until heated through.
